GOVTRUST | Summer School | Antwerp Summer University

Summer School | 19 - 23 August 2024

Master the ins and outs of trust and public governance from a multi-level perspective, while considering the context of grand societal challenges. Drawing on high-level scientific expertise from multiple disciplines (incl. political science, communication science, law, behavioural economics and public administration), you gain a comprehensive understanding of the dynamics, causes and effects of trust in and between societal actors in multi-level public governance for societal transitions. 

What's in store?

✅ Exciting keynote by Prof. Joe Hamm (Michigan State University, USA) on the intersection of trust and vulnerability

✅ Multiple thematic sessions: e.g. defining and theorising trust; trust and regulatory governance; political trust; trust and multi-level governance in the EU; trust and judicial governance; …

✅ Renowned guest speakers including Joe Hamm (Michigan State University, USA), Ben Seyd (University of Kent, UK), Frédérique Six (VU Amsterdam, NL), Tina Øllgaard Bentzen (Roskilde University, DK)

✅ Expert GOVTRUST lecturers including Koen Verhoest, Esther van Zimmeren, Peter Bursens, Patricia Popelier, Michel Walrave, and many more

✅ Workshops to sharpen your research methods and to discuss participants’ own research with peers and academic experts
